Before talking about the callback function, you might as well look at a piece of code first. I believe that students with some basic js can understand its meaning:
document.getElementById('demo').click=function(){ alert(1); };
This code is actually an event callback. It is actually relatively vague when written this way. We might as well look at the next code
document.getElementById('demo').addEventListener('click',function(){ alert(1) });
The two pieces of code actually do the same thing. The only difference is the way of writing. Let’s look at thisaddEventListener('eventName',callback)
,addEventListener
this The function has two parameters. The first one is the event name, and the second parameter is actually the callback function. According to the callback function method in the book, since the parameters in the function can be variables, then it can also be a function. Maybe everyone is still confused about returning functions at this point. Let's look at the next example.
function demo(a,b,callback){ let c=a+b; callback(c); }; demo(1,2,function(c){ alert(c);//3 })
This code defines a demo function. This function has three parameters a, b, callback. We declare a local variable c inside this function. , and then execute our callback (callback function), and then execute the demo function
The three parameters of this function are as above, and the value that pops up in the callback function is 3. This is a simple callback function. To truly understand the meaning of the callback function, I actually think it depends on understanding its purpose. Only by understanding its purpose can we truly understand it.
The most common application scenario for callback functions is asynchronous operations. Because for asynchronous operations, we don’t know when the operation will end, then the code we execute subsequently cannot follow the proper process.
